What is a Medical Alert System?

A medical alert system is made to provide comfort for the family members and loved ones of those who might encounter medical distress in and out of the home. They have been made to alert family members and contact emergency workers when it comes to a health emergency.

Types Of Medical Alert Systemsā€‹

HOME-BASED MEDICAL ALERT SYSTEM

A device built for useĀ at homeĀ will have a base with a 2-way speaker as well as mic. It will also have a mobile button to be worn by the customer. Pushing the button will connect the user to the monitoring device.

The home-based system will only operate within the range of the base. It may be used with a landline phone or with a mobile phone.

With the home-based system, you can often add a fall detection button also.

MOBILE ALERT SYSTEM

With a mobile unit, it is simplerĀ to move aroundĀ in the community and also know that you can still receive support if you need it. A cellular system works without needing a base station and also works wherever there is cellular service available.

Mobile systems include:

  • GPS tracking ā€“ This works if users regularly leave the home to do their errands or if they have a tendency to stray away and even get lost easily. Having GPS means that if someone is lost, he can contact the emergency response centre and a person can be directed to the accurate location.
  • Built-in cell service ā€“ The integrated cell service may be used to call the emergency monitoring centre.
  • Fall detection ā€“ The device can identify a fall and also make an automatic call for help. This works if the individual can not get to the button or is not responsive and not able to make a call.
  • Waterproof ā€“ This function allows the equipment to be worn in the shower to make sure that if a fall takes place, support can be sent.

ALL-IN-ONE MOBILE GPS SYSTEM

An all in one system includes all the features you need in a medic alert system. It will have a light-weight help switch that is simple to remove and put on. It is simple to recharge and also can be put on a docking station when it is not being operated.

The user puts on the help button that is used to connect them to an emergency agent that can send out the proper assistance. The help switch is also a speaker, whereby the individual can speak into in the instance that they can not get to a phone.

This type of system will additionally have integrated GPS tracking to make sure that the location of the user can be identified.

Most medical alert companies offer Medical Alert Systems with Fall Detection with their devices. See if this is a feature you need:

A fall detection-enhanced system will instantly call for help in case you experience an accident, even if you are not able to push your medical alert button. Gowrie medical alert professionals, typically, recommend fall detection to individuals with health problems like epilepsy, Parkinsonā€™s disease, diabetes, as well as Multiple Sclerosis, or for those who just want an additional layer of coverage.

Note: Medical Alert System with Fall Detection does not recognize 100% of falls. If Individual is able, Individual should push the help button in the event of an emergency situation. The 911 emergency services line is an alternative to the fall detection system and also the Service providers. Fall Detection should be displayed around the neck to enable adequate detection of falls.

How Medical Alerts Typically Work

Press Your Medical Alert Button

In the event of an emergency, press your pendant or portable emergency button.

GPS monitoring can pinpoint your specific location, which enables emergency medical services to reach you sooner.

Connect with a Medical Monitoring Center to Explain Your Situation

Two-way communication with emergency operators assesses the situation.

They will have all your medical information and location. They will also help you through the emergency situation.

Receive Immediate Assistance

Help is on the Way!

Emergency medical operators will contacts your priority list or emergency services based on your specific needs.
